Introduction
In the summer of 1991, a routine Boy Scout expedition to Southern California's highest peak, Mount San Gorgonio, took a tragic turn when 12-year-old Jared Michael Negrete vanished without a trace. Despite extensive search efforts, his disappearance remains one of the most haunting unsolved cases in the region.
The Fateful Expedition
On July 19, 1991, Jared, an eighth-grader from El Monte, California, embarked on his first overnight backpacking trip with his Boy Scout troop. The group aimed to summit the 11,500-foot Mount San Gorgonio in the San Bernardino National Forest. As the troop ascended, Jared began to lag behind, approximately 1,000 feet from the summit.
